Identify the parent function of f ( x ) = − 4 | x − 2 | .

Respuesta :

AnsweringGod
AnsweringGod AnsweringGod
  • 23-05-2024

Answer:

The parent function of f(x) = -4|x - 2| is the absolute value function f(x) = |x|.

Step-by-step explanation:

The parent function of f(x) = -4 |x - 2| is the absolute value function f(x) = |x|, which is reflected over the x-axis and vertically stretched by a factor of 4.
